PA state trooper shot in the line of duty

(Northampton County, PA)  --  A State Police Corporal is fighting for his life following a shooting in Plainfield Township.  Detectives say a traffic stop turned violent yesterday and the suspect, who was allegedly intoxicated, began to fight with the corporal and another trooper when they tried to arrest him.  The man pulled a gun and fired several shots, hitting the corporal three times.  The officers returned fire and the suspect was also shot and taken to the hospital.  The corporal underwent surgery and is in "extremely critical" but stable condition.
